To secure the safety of both kids and dogs, understanding a dogs body language is the very important. Species behavior and emotional needs of the dogs and families alike come into play. Kids and dogs can be a complex relationship. Different stages and ages of the children will need different levels of supervision and boundaries. That also holds true for the dog. If guardians go into the puppy/child, dog/child relationship based on a realistic expectation, everyone including the dog has a much better chance of success.
